Ever wonder how you could run a successful therapy business while living life on the road? In this episode of The Traveling Therapist Podcast, I chat with Dr. Elizabeth Carr, founder and CEO of Kentlands Psychotherapy, about scaling a private practice from anywhere, even an Airstream camper. Elizabeth shares how her practice grew from a solo venture into a thriving team of over 20 clinicians, all while she and her husband embraced a full-time travel lifestyle with their dog Riley and cat Atticus.

She breaks down the mindset shifts, leadership changes, and contingency planning that helped her transition from full-time clinician to full-time CEO. If you're dreaming of scaling your business, creating flexibility, and maybe even selling it one day, this episode is packed with insight.

In This Episode, We Explore…

  • How Dr. Carr transitioned from Navy psychologist to group practice owner
  • Why she restructured her role to support a travel lifestyle
  • The steps to moving from clinician to full-time leadership
  • Planning for continuity and legacy in your therapy business
  • Her strategy for staying clinically active without burnout
